Lokvansh
Descendant of the people
Pronunciation: lok-VAHNSH (lɔkʋɑ̃ʃ)
What does Lokvansh mean?
One who comes from the lineage of the common people; a ruler who is close to his subjects and understands their needs and struggles.

Spiritual & cultural context
Symbolizes a leader who governs with compassion and empathy towards his people.
The name "Lokvansh" has significant cultural impact, emphasizing the importance of being connected to one's people. In Hinduism, the concept of "Loka" represents the common people or the public, while "Vansh" signifies a lineage or a dynasty. A person named Lokvansh is thus perceived as a ruler or leader who is rooted in his cultural heritage and is sensitive to the needs and concerns of the masses. This is in line with the Indian tradition of a ruler being seen as a serving the needs of the people.
